
Question from YouTube from Christian a mechanic and a crypto and blockchain enthusiast from NevadaAmira Al-Thani (Blockchain Specialist):Discussion Question: How do light clients verify chain state under weak assumptions without trusting full nodes?My Response:So light clients are actually one of the most elegant solutions in blockchain architecture. Let me break down how they maintain security without full trust.Core Verification Mechanism:Light clients use Merkle proofs to verify transactions without downloading the entire blockchain. Here's the technical flow:Block Headers Only: Light clients download just block headers (~80 bytes on Bitcoin, ~500 bytes on Ethereum), which contain the Merkle root of all transactionsMerkle Proof Verification: When querying a specific transaction, full nodes provide a Merkle proof (log(n) hashes) proving that transaction is included in the blockCryptographic Guarantee: The light client verifies the proof mathematically - if the hash chain leads to the Merkle root in the header, the transaction is provably includedWeak Assumptions Framework:Light clients operate under these minimal trust assumptions:- At least ONE honest full node exists in the network (1-of-N honest majority)- The consensus mechanism (PoW/PoS) is functioning correctly- Cryptographic hash functions remain collision-resistantThey DON'T assume:- All nodes are honest- The network is censorship-free- All data is immediately availableOn Solana (Our Chain):Solana's light client implementation uses:- Proof of History (PoH): Verifiable delay function creates cryptographic timestamps- Turbine Block Propagation: Sharded data availability allows partial verification- State Compression: Merkle trees enable efficient state proofs for SPL tokens like $SiCiCoinSmart Contract Implications:For platforms like SiCierto, this matters because:- Users can verify their $SiCiCoin token balance without running a full node- Game rewards can be cryptographically proven without trusting our servers- Mobile wallets (Phantom, Solflare) use light client tech to verify transactions instantlyDeFi Security Angle:Light clients enable trustless bridges and cross-chain DeFi by:- Verifying state proofs from other chains (fraud-proof systems)- Enabling optimistic rollups with challenge periods- Supporting validity proofs (zk-SNARKs) for instant finalityThe Trust Trade-off:Light clients sacrifice some security vs. full nodes:- Data Availability Risk: Malicious validators could withhold data- Eclipse Attacks: If all connected peers are malicious, they can lie about chain state- Mitigation: Connect to multiple diverse nodes, use fraud-proof watchtowers, implement random samplingModern Solutions:- Ethereum's Altair Upgrade: Light client sync committees (512 validators attest to headers)- NIPoPoWs (Non-Interactive Proofs of Proof-of-Work): Superlight clients with logarithmic proof size- Data Availability Sampling (DAS): Clients randomly sample chunks to detect withheld dataFor SiCierto users, this means your mobile wallet doesn't need to download gigabytes of blockchain data - it cryptographically verifies just what matters to YOU while maintaining security guarantees. Pretty cool intersection of cryptography and practical usability. XMei-Ling Zhou (Marketing Lead):Hmm, this is actually a really important technical question that affects how we position SiCierto's educational value.So here's the thing - questions like this show there's a huge knowledge gap in crypto. Most people don't understand the technical underpinnings of blockchain verification, and that's EXACTLY why SiCierto exists.From a marketing perspective, this highlights a few key opportunities:Educational Content Gap: We should create beginner-friendly content explaining concepts like light clients, chain state verification, and trust models. This positions us as educators first, memecoin second. Content marketing gold.Game Development Angle: We could develop a future game module that gamifies blockchain verification concepts - maybe "Chain Validator Challenge" where players learn about Merkle proofs, state roots, and verification mechanics while earning $SiCiCoin tokens.Community Trust Building: When we explain that SiCierto runs on Solana (which uses Proof of History + Proof of Stake for fast verification), we're showing transparency about our technical foundation. This builds credibility with technically-minded users who ask questions like this.Messaging Strategy: We can use this to refine our pitch - "Learn blockchain fundamentals through games, not dry technical docs." Questions like this prove there's demand for accessible crypto education.Honestly though, for newcomers to SiCierto, I'd simplify this to: "Light clients let you verify blockchain data without downloading the entire blockchain - kind of like checking a receipt instead of auditing the whole store's books. Solana makes this super efficient, which is why our games run smoothly and rewards distribute quickly."The real growth hack here? Create a "Blockchain Basics" mini-course as gated content - users earn bonus $SiCiCoin for completing it. Captures emails, educates users, increases token circulation, and positions us as thought leaders. Win-win-win-win. X** via /r/SiCierto https://ift.tt/BUPWyoH
Social Media Icons